X射线致人外周血线粒体DNA 4977bp缺失的时效关系研究

摘    要:采集2名25岁健康男性外周血进行不同剂量(0~10 Gy)单次X射线照射,于照后取不同时间点(2、12、24、48和72 h)培养的细胞提取基因组DNA,利用实时定量PCR检测不同时间点线粒体DNA(mtDNA)4977bp缺失情况,探讨X射线致人外周血mtDNA 4977bp缺失的时间效应关系。结果表明,受照剂量为5 Gy时,随着照射后培养时间的增加,mtDNA 4977bp缺失拷贝数、mtDNA总拷贝数和mtDNA 4977bp缺失率均有增加趋势。培养时间为24 h和72 h时,在0~10 Gy剂量范围内mtDNA 4977bp缺失拷贝数、mtDNA总拷贝数和mtDNA 4977bp缺失率随着受照剂量的增加而增加。提示X射线诱发的mtDNA 4977bp缺失和mtDNA总拷贝数具有时间和剂量累积性。

关 键 词:X射线  线粒体DNA  4977bp缺失  时效关系
